How they compare
Germany currently reports -2.1% against -2.4% in Algeria, a difference of 0.3%.
The two have swapped places 10 times across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Germany ahead.
Algeria ranks 153rd and Germany ranks 150th of 186 countries.
Germany has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Algeria | Germany |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.0% | 5.0% | 4.0% | Germany |
| 2010s | -1.9% | 4.5% | 6.3% | Germany |
| 2020s | -0.0% | 0.2% | 0.2% | Germany |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
